Single-Close Construction-to-Permanent Loans

This popular option combines the construction phase and the permanent mortgage into one loan with a single closing. Ideal for new home builds in Troup, it simplifies the process by avoiding a second closing once construction is complete. During the building phase, funds are disbursed in draws as work progresses, and the loan converts seamlessly to a standard mortgage. This is particularly applicable for residential projects in areas like Smith County or the 75789 Zip Code, where streamlined financing can help manage timelines efficiently. Two-Time Close Loans

Also known as construction-only loans, these require two separate closings: one for the short-term construction loan and another for the permanent mortgage after completion. This type suits borrowers who anticipate changes in interest rates or financial situations between phases. It's well-suited for additions to existing homes or larger-scale projects in Troup, providing flexibility for custom builds or phased commercial developments. Renovation Construction Loans

Designed for updating or expanding existing structures, these loans cover costs for renovations, such as kitchen remodels, room additions, or converting spaces for commercial use. In Troup, they're perfect for revitalizing older homes or adapting properties for business purposes. Funds are released in stages based on renovation milestones, ensuring controlled spending. Eligibility Criteria Specific to Texas Regulations

To qualify for construction loans in Texas, including Troup, applicants typically need a minimum credit score of 620, though higher scores (680+) unlock better rates. Stable income is required, often verified through two years of employment history and a debt-to-income ratio under 45%. Down payment expectations range from 5-20%, depending on the loan type—FHA-backed options may allow as low as 3.5%, while conventional loans often require 20% for construction phases. Texas regulations emphasize builder licensing and environmental compliance, which we help navigate. Key Documents Needed

To streamline your application for a construction loan in Troup, Texas, assemble these critical documents:

  • Blueprints: Detailed architectural plans outlining the structure, dimensions, and materials.
  • Builder Contracts: Legally binding agreements with your chosen contractor, including scope of work and timelines.
  • Budgets: A line-item budget covering all projected expenses, from foundation to finishing touches.
  • Permits: Building permits approved by Troup city officials, ensuring your project meets local codes.

Having these ready demonstrates preparedness and can accelerate approval. Our loan officers can advise on any additional requirements specific to Texas construction projects.

Calculating Loan Payments for Constructions

Understanding how to calculate loan payments for construction projects in Troup, Texas, is essential for effective budgeting and planning. At Summit Lending, we specialize in construction loans that support your building needs across Texas. Construction loans typically divide into two phases: the draw period and the permanent phase, each with distinct payment structures.

During the draw period, which covers the active construction time, payments are often interest-only. This means you pay just the interest on the funds drawn so far, rather than principal, keeping initial costs lower while your project progresses. For example, if you're building a home in Troup, you might draw funds in stages as construction milestones are met, and your monthly payments adjust accordingly based on the amount disbursed.

Once construction completes, the loan transitions to the permanent phase, converting to a standard mortgage with principal and interest payments. This shift increases monthly amounts but spreads the principal repayment over a longer term, such as 15 or 30 years. To get a clear picture of this transition, explore our mortgage loans options tailored for Texas residents.

Several factors influence these payments. Interest rates, which fluctuate based on market conditions and your credit, directly affect costs—lower rates mean smaller interest-only payments during construction. The loan amount, determined by your project's total cost, scales the overall obligation. Construction duration impacts the draw period length; longer timelines in Troup might extend interest-only phases but increase total interest accrued. Additionally, Texas-specific fees, like property taxes, insurance, and potential state filing costs, add to the equation and should be factored into your estimates.

Texas state regulations play a crucial role in construction lending, ensuring transparency and compliance. Lenders must adhere to strict disclosure requirements under the Texas Finance Code, including clear terms on interest rates, fees, and repayment schedules for construction loans. Environmental considerations are paramount, particularly in areas like Smith County, where projects may require assessments for flood zones or soil stability due to the region's East Texas terrain.
